D. imitator care sheet
One of my D. imitator with two tadpoles on his back. Photo by Trevor Anderson. |
Scientific name:
|
D. imitator
|
Nickname:
|
thumb-nail dart
|
Nation of origin:
|
Peru
|
Tank size & Shape:
|
15-20 gal tall
|
Preferred Temperatures (fahrenheit):
|
Low 70s to mid 70s day temp and to mid 60s at night.
|
Humidity:
|
High, 80-100% (especially in the top of the tank).
|
Food Choice:
|
Fruitflies or slightly smaller in upper part of tank.
|
